Performance - and Planning – Systems and Documents are isolated:

BI used successfully in Performance Management

Strategy and planning tools that are the basis of Performance Management: Process of aligning, mapping and collating disparate systems

is time consuming As a result there is just enough time to produce reports but no

time to analyse and extract insight Need and urgency to action performance challenges is not

realized Inefficiencies and exceptions are not identified promptly

How can BI be used successfully as a IA Tool

BI used successfully in Internal Audit

The Institute of Internal Auditors (IIA) defines Internal Auditing as:

“…an independent, objective assurance and consulting activity designed to add value and improve an organization’s operations. It helps an organization accomplish its objectives by bringing a systematic, disciplined approach to evaluate and improve the

effectiveness of risk management, control and governance processes.”

Computer Aided-, Technology based- and Automated Auditing

BI used successfully in Internal Audit

Internal Auditing organisations including the IIA “provide guidance and guidelines for the use of automated tools to help with the efficiency and effectiveness of the auditing processes. Technology-based auditing techniques, in particular, can play an important role in the auditing process.”

Technology-based techniques and data analytics techniques are used for automated tests of transactions and activities.
